JAVA Thread 자바 스레드 part01
이번 글은 내가 이해하기 위해 글을 올립니다. 공부하면서 이해하기 어려운 부분인 것 같습니다. synchronized는 1. 메서드 전체에 임계 영역 지정하거나 synchronized public static void run(){ ... } 2. 특졍 한 영역을 임계 영역으로 지정한다. 이때 들어갈 것은 참조변수여 합니다. package ThreadPackage; class Thread02 implements Runnable{ public static int num = 0; public static Object lock1 = new Object(); //임계영역을 담당할 참조변수 @Override public void run() { for(int i=0; i < 100; i++) { synchronize..
Language/JAVA
2021. 8. 26. 20:28